The Huber Heights Senior Center provides a dedicated community hub for older adults in the Dayton, OH area. It offers a range of services designed to support the well-being and engagement of its senior members.
Social activities and eventsHealth and wellness programsEducational workshopsInformation and referral servicesRecreational opportunities
